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Carpenter-Ridgeway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Carpenter-Ridgeway with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Carpenter-Ridgeway is at Madison Mayfair Apartments listed at $1,050.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Carpenter-Ridgeway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Carpenter-Ridgeway is $2,079.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Carpenter-Ridgeway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Carpenter-Ridgeway is a 1,266 square feet unit starting from $2,985 at The Marling Apartments.

What is the average size for Carpenter-Ridgeway 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Carpenter-Ridgeway is currently 959 sq ft.
